Toastmasters: It's the Talk of Twinsburg

Twinsburg Toastmasters meets on Monday evenings at the Cleveland Clinic

The Twinsburg Toastmasters Club is up and running in the city.

A newly formed open-enrollment affiliate of Toastmasters International has launched with 16 energetic members and is well on its way toward full club strength of 20 members, according to a club press release.

The group meets Mondays from 6:45-8 p.m. at The Cleveland Clinic Family Health & Surgery Center, 8701 Darrow Road, in the lower level educational classroom.

Toastmasters' mission is to provide a mutually supportive and positive learning environment in which every member has the opportunity to develop communication and leadership skills while fostering self-confidence and personal growth.

“It has been a dream of mine to develop a thriving Toastmasters Club in Twinsburg,” Dennis Deegan, club sponsor, resident and veteran Toastmaster,said. “If you want to make new friends and have fun while learning, Toastmasters is that club.”

The club achieves its mission by having a structured program whereby members present prepared speeches developed at their own pace and are then given useful feedback on the strengths of their delivery and suggestions for improvement.

Members also practice their impromptu speaking skills and all are provided one of many roles at meetings so everyone gets to speak.
